]> git.mxchange.org Git - addressbook-mailer-ejb.git/commitdiff
introduced addressbook-mailer which is a mailer class for the addressbook project
authorRoland Haeder <roland@mxchange.org>
Fri, 1 Apr 2016 18:28:05 +0000 (20:28 +0200)
committerRoland Haeder <roland@mxchange.org>
Fri, 1 Apr 2016 18:28:05 +0000 (20:28 +0200)
lib/addressbook-mailer.jar [new file with mode: 0644]
lib/jmailer-ee.jar
nbproject/build-impl.xml
nbproject/genfiles.properties
nbproject/project.properties
nbproject/project.xml
src/java/org/mxchange/jusercore/model/email_address/AddressbookEmailChangeSessionBean.java

diff --git a/lib/addressbook-mailer.jar b/lib/addressbook-mailer.jar
new file mode 100644 (file)
index 0000000..a3c369f
Binary files /dev/null and b/lib/addressbook-mailer.jar differ
index ec343a7cc8b5b2bfa7d1581a51a80d6435b9a38e..6874cfe8851ca81ce3863a345d53a98a8a24b632 100644 (file)
Binary files a/lib/jmailer-ee.jar and b/lib/jmailer-ee.jar differ
index ba62e202a2be6649b2aa4a0b13f86539c28410f5..42cd1337471369f3f73a11ca5a31903b79e62359 100644 (file)
@@ -842,6 +842,7 @@ exists or setup the property manually. For example like this:
         <copyfiles files="${file.reference.juser-core.jar}" todir="${build.classes.dir}"/>
         <copyfiles files="${file.reference.juser-lib.jar}" todir="${build.classes.dir}"/>
         <copyfiles files="${file.reference.jmailer-ee.jar}" todir="${build.classes.dir}"/>
+        <copyfiles files="${file.reference.addressbook-mailer.jar}" todir="${build.classes.dir}"/>
         <copyfiles files="${reference.addressbook-lib.jar}" todir="${build.classes.dir}"/>
         <copyfiles files="${reference.juser-core.jar}" todir="${build.classes.dir}"/>
     </target>
@@ -856,10 +857,11 @@ exists or setup the property manually. For example like this:
         <basename file="${file.reference.juser-core.jar}" property="manifest.file.reference.juser-core.jar"/>
         <basename file="${file.reference.juser-lib.jar}" property="manifest.file.reference.juser-lib.jar"/>
         <basename file="${file.reference.jmailer-ee.jar}" property="manifest.file.reference.jmailer-ee.jar"/>
+        <basename file="${file.reference.addressbook-mailer.jar}" property="manifest.file.reference.addressbook-mailer.jar"/>
         <basename file="${reference.addressbook-lib.jar}" property="manifest.reference.addressbook-lib.jar"/>
         <basename file="${reference.juser-core.jar}" property="manifest.reference.juser-core.jar"/>
         <manifest file="${build.ear.classes.dir}/META-INF/MANIFEST.MF" mode="update">
-            <attribute name="Extension-List" value="jar-1 jar-2 jar-3 jar-4 jar-5 jar-6 jar-7 jar-8 jar-9 jar-10 jar-11 jar-12 "/>
+            <attribute name="Extension-List" value="jar-1 jar-2 jar-3 jar-4 jar-5 jar-6 jar-7 jar-8 jar-9 jar-10 jar-11 jar-12 jar-13 "/>
             <attribute name="jar-1-Extension-Name" value="${manifest.file.reference.jcore.jar}"/>
             <attribute name="jar-2-Extension-Name" value="${manifest.file.reference.jcoreee.jar}"/>
             <attribute name="jar-3-Extension-Name" value="${manifest.file.reference.jcore-logger-lib.jar}"/>
@@ -870,8 +872,9 @@ exists or setup the property manually. For example like this:
             <attribute name="jar-8-Extension-Name" value="${manifest.file.reference.juser-core.jar}"/>
             <attribute name="jar-9-Extension-Name" value="${manifest.file.reference.juser-lib.jar}"/>
             <attribute name="jar-10-Extension-Name" value="${manifest.file.reference.jmailer-ee.jar}"/>
-            <attribute name="jar-11-Extension-Name" value="${manifest.reference.addressbook-lib.jar}"/>
-            <attribute name="jar-12-Extension-Name" value="${manifest.reference.juser-core.jar}"/>
+            <attribute name="jar-11-Extension-Name" value="${manifest.file.reference.addressbook-mailer.jar}"/>
+            <attribute name="jar-12-Extension-Name" value="${manifest.reference.addressbook-lib.jar}"/>
+            <attribute name="jar-13-Extension-Name" value="${manifest.reference.juser-core.jar}"/>
         </manifest>
     </target>
     <target depends="compile" name="library-inclusion-in-manifest">
@@ -885,6 +888,7 @@ exists or setup the property manually. For example like this:
         <copyfiles files="${file.reference.juser-core.jar}" todir="${dist.ear.dir}/lib"/>
         <copyfiles files="${file.reference.juser-lib.jar}" todir="${dist.ear.dir}/lib"/>
         <copyfiles files="${file.reference.jmailer-ee.jar}" todir="${dist.ear.dir}/lib"/>
+        <copyfiles files="${file.reference.addressbook-mailer.jar}" todir="${dist.ear.dir}/lib"/>
         <copyfiles files="${reference.addressbook-lib.jar}" todir="${dist.ear.dir}/lib"/>
         <copyfiles files="${reference.juser-core.jar}" todir="${dist.ear.dir}/lib"/>
         <manifest file="${build.ear.classes.dir}/META-INF/MANIFEST.MF" mode="update"/>
index 566ff5d387fb7509d1ea6dd1ff154c06d5dad43c..0438788b5a0222082417fbb1f22f68b41c0fba17 100644 (file)
@@ -3,6 +3,6 @@ build.xml.script.CRC32=7d41e0fd
 build.xml.stylesheet.CRC32=5910fda3@1.51.1
 # This file is used by a NetBeans-based IDE to track changes in generated files such as build-impl.xml.
 # Do not edit this file. You may delete it but then the IDE will never regenerate such files for you.
-nbproject/build-impl.xml.data.CRC32=4a04b58e
-nbproject/build-impl.xml.script.CRC32=5b2dfdcd
+nbproject/build-impl.xml.data.CRC32=bc3e0f41
+nbproject/build-impl.xml.script.CRC32=9c66876e
 nbproject/build-impl.xml.stylesheet.CRC32=6096d939@1.55.1
index de73a6c52e5523fd76f7df7ac73058156bc11449..7a428466f4e6c69a8a08ae32b10928fb4e843694 100644 (file)
@@ -21,6 +21,7 @@ dist.jar=${dist.dir}/${jar.name}
 dist.javadoc.dir=${dist.dir}/javadoc
 endorsed.classpath=
 excludes=
+file.reference.addressbook-mailer.jar=lib/addressbook-mailer.jar
 file.reference.jcontacts-business-core.jar=lib/jcontacts-business-core.jar
 file.reference.jcontacts-core.jar=lib/jcontacts-core.jar
 file.reference.jcore-logger-lib.jar=lib/jcore-logger-lib.jar
@@ -56,6 +57,7 @@ javac.classpath=\
     ${file.reference.juser-core.jar}:\
     ${file.reference.juser-lib.jar}:\
     ${file.reference.jmailer-ee.jar}:\
+    ${file.reference.addressbook-mailer.jar}:\
     ${reference.addressbook-lib.jar}:\
     ${reference.juser-core.jar}
 javac.compilerargs=-Xlint:unchecked -Xlint:deprecation
@@ -97,6 +99,7 @@ run.test.classpath=\
 # (you may also define separate properties like run-sys-prop.name=value instead of -Dname=value):
 runmain.jvmargs=
 source.encoding=UTF-8
+source.reference.addressbook-mailer.jar=../addressbook-mailer/src/
 source.reference.jcontacts-business-core.jar=../jcontacts-business-core/src/
 source.reference.jcontacts-core.jar=../jcontacts-core/src/
 source.reference.jcore-logger-lib.jar=../jcore-logger-lib/src/
index 098497ac9caa9937697fa602a50cd44df0280b4b..7290bc76fb4d78ff9c5bc142f79e018eb652ce10 100644 (file)
@@ -15,6 +15,7 @@
             <included-library dirs="200">file.reference.juser-core.jar</included-library>
             <included-library dirs="200">file.reference.juser-lib.jar</included-library>
             <included-library dirs="200">file.reference.jmailer-ee.jar</included-library>
+            <included-library dirs="200">file.reference.addressbook-mailer.jar</included-library>
             <included-library dirs="200">reference.addressbook-lib.jar</included-library>
             <included-library dirs="200">reference.juser-core.jar</included-library>
             <source-roots>
index 88d2c6e22149007523ab2983f762089f0bf77fb6..09d1ec85874b8ec21b3406da90f85a353622c7fc 100644 (file)
@@ -36,9 +36,9 @@ import javax.naming.InitialContext;
 import javax.naming.NamingException;
 import javax.persistence.NoResultException;
 import javax.persistence.Query;
+import org.mxchange.addressbook.mailer.model.delivery.AddressbookMailer;
+import org.mxchange.addressbook.mailer.model.delivery.DeliverableAddressbookEmail;
 import org.mxchange.jcoreee.database.BaseDatabaseBean;
-import org.mxchange.jmailee.model.delivery.DeliverableEmail;
-import org.mxchange.jmailee.model.delivery.Mailer;
 import org.mxchange.jusercore.model.user.UserSessionBeanRemote;
 import org.mxchange.jusercore.model.user.UserUtils;
 
@@ -146,9 +146,8 @@ public class AddressbookEmailChangeSessionBean extends BaseDatabaseBean implemen
 
                // Persist it
                //this.getEntityManager().persist(emailChange);
-
                // Get mailer instance
-               DeliverableEmail mailer = new Mailer();
+               DeliverableAddressbookEmail mailer = new AddressbookMailer();
 
                // Send out email change
                mailer.sendEmailChangeMail(this.messageProducer, this.message, emailChange);